The National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A) Office of Space Science is releasing an Announcement of Opportunity (AO 01-OSS-05) entitled Next Generation Space Telescope (NGST) Flight Investigations. Selection of proposals through this AO are intended to provide NASA with science investigations associated with an instrument capable of achieving NGST imaging goals in the near infrared (a collaborative effort with the Canadian Space Agency), science investigations associated one Mid-Infrared Instrument Science Lead, science investigations associated with three other team members for the Mid-Infrared Science Team, science investigations associated with one NGST Facility Scientist, science investigations associated with one NGST Telescope Scientist, and science investigations associated with four Interdisciplinary Scientists. The primary science goal of the NGST mission is to advance the understanding of the formation of the first stars and galaxies. Participation is open to all categories of organizations, foreign and domestic, including industry, educational institutions, nonprofit organizations, NASA centers, and other Government agencies.
